How they compare

Aruba currently reports 97.63 units per square kilometre against 94.68 units per square kilometre in Saint Martin (French Part), a difference of 2.95 units per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 13 shared years of data; in 2011 it was Aruba ahead.

Aruba ranks 13th and Saint Martin (French Part) ranks 15th of 215 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Aruba averaged higher in 1 and Saint Martin (French Part) in 1.
